    The role as a Solar Panel Installer:

    • Conduct electrical wiring and connections for solar panels and install cabling, conduits and related electrical equipment according to specifications.
    • Electrical Installation, testing and commissioning in accordance with technical specifications and industry standards to ensure a fully functional solar power plant.
    • Comprehensive diagnostics tests to detect issues in electrical components, connections and overall performance.
    • Prompt and effective repair services to resolve any faults minimising downtime and ensuring continuous operations.
    • Conduct series of stringent tests to evaluate the system s performance and safety.
    • Perform routine maintenance checks on installed systems to ensure optimal performance.
    • Provide detailed reports and certification documents confirming compliance with industry standards and regulations.
    • Collaborate with team members to ensure timely project completion.
    • Must adhere to all on-site safety protocols, including Lockout/Tagout procedures and use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E).

    The skills and qualifications needed to be successful in this Solar Panel Installers Role:

    • Experienced with a full understanding of Solar PV on business premises or open land.
    • NVQ L3 or equivalent, 18th Edition & 2391 Qualifications
    • In depth experience of installing Solar Modules including connecting DC cables via MC4 connectors
    • Experience of Ground (CPC) electrical equipment and checking AC & DC wiring.
    • Experience working at height
    • Full understanding of Solar PV Electrical designs and layouts (Minimum 2 years)
    • Fully understand the importance of carrying out works stipulated within the RAMS/CPP and the need to ensure all methods are followed.
    • Adhere to strict health and safety guidelines and ensure the team is working within the expectations stipulated within the companies policies and procedures
    • Basic Knowledge of Microsoft Outlook, excel and Word
    • Full UK driving licence
